Cengiz Hasman, a National Master with an impressive FIDE rating of 2101, resides in Kyrenia, Cyprus. He learned chess at the age of nine in London and began taking group lessons at eleven. Cengiz experienced rapid development as a teenager, primarily through self-study and an extensive array of chess literature. Since 2012, he has benefited from coaching sessions with a Grand Master, which further refined his skills and deepened his understanding of the game.
Cengiz is well-versed in various game formats, having participated in a staggering 2,922 bullet games with an exceptional rating of 2574. In addition, he boasts a solid blitz rating of 2514 from 36 games and has also engaged in correspondence and chess960 formats.
